Well deserved. In a field where so many 'stars' are lionized over their excesses and shenanigans, Ringo is someone more known for his skill, wit, and generosity. In the 1979 Beatles bio-pic, there is the following exchange between John Lennon and Beatle's manager Brian Epstein:

Quote:

John, I want you to remember something. No single one of you is The Beatles. Each one of you is a part. Paul is the heart of the group, George is the soul, you're the mind.

John Lennon: And Ringo?

Brian Epstein: He's the flesh and blood.

If the one thing anyone is known for in their life is just being a good human being, it beats any other accolade...
